Kocher+Beck shows die-cutting technology at Labelexpo

The company is also demonstrating its commitment to sustainability through innovations and a recycled stand.

Kocher+Beck is exhibiting its technology portfolio at stand 3E47 at Labelexpo Europe 2025.

The company is showcasing its GapMaster EM (Electronic Move) alongside the new Variable Gap System. Additionally, Kocher+Beck is introducing a new generation of anti-stick coatings for flexible dies, resulting in less adhesive residue on the cutting edges. This new coating is certified for all applications, including pharmaceutical and medical uses, and is compliant with environmental standards. 

Advancements in die-cutting technology include the new Industry 4.0-ready digital KMS Pressure Gauge System and the latest motorized version, which is equipped with various sensors and provides higher stability under varying loads. Another highlight is the Quick-Change die-cutting station, which allows magnetic cylinders to be pre-mounted during the current job and exchanged in seconds. 

TecScreen has improved its processing unit. The unit now features the capability to store and recycle water, demonstrating commitment to sustainability. 

Additionally, Kocher+Beck's exhibition stand is constructed from materials previously used at Labelexpo Europe 2023, and the company is reusing its furniture and UV equipment.
